    Intended Use

    The Spectra Q is a powered breast pump to be used by lactating women to express and collect milk from their breasts. The Spectra Q is intended for home use by a single user.

    Device Description

    The Spectra Q breast pump is comprised of a Spectra Q pump, breast shield (20, 24, 28, 32 mm), backflow protector, silicone valve, tubing, bottles (including the nipple, cap, cover, and disk), 2-wav connector (for double pumping), and power adapters. The breast pump is provided with one 24 mm and one 28 mm breast shield. Optional components include a small cap converter, assembled with the feeding bottle, the 20 and 32 mm breast shields, and a wide bottle stand. The Spectra Q breast pump is used by lactating women to express and collect milk from their breasts. The pump is intended for home use by a single user. Pumping with the Spectra Q breast pump can be performed on one breast (single pumping) or on both breasts at the same time (double pumping). The Spectra O breast pump allows the user to adjust the vacuum levels. Two suction patterns, massage and expression mode, are pre-programmed with variable vacuum levels and cycle rates (pump speed). The powered breast pump is capable of providing vacuum levels from -50 to -270 mmHq with cycle rates up to 110 cycles per minute. The device is powered by a 6 V AC/DC power adapter or a 5 V USB C type power adapter. The device is provided non-sterile.

    The provided text is related to the K191109 510(k) clearance for the Spectra Q breast pump. It describes the device, its intended use, and its substantial equivalence to a predicate device (Spectra 9Plus).

    However, the document does not contain information about acceptance criteria or a study proving the device meets those criteria in the context of AI/ML or diagnostic performance. The non-clinical tests mentioned are primarily related to:

    • Electrical Safety/Electromagnetic Compatibility: Compliance with standards like AAMI / ANSI ES60601-1, IEC 60601-1-2, and IEC 60601-1-11.
    • Software Validation: In accordance with FDA Guidance for software in medical devices (May 11, 2005).
    • Biocompatibility: Evaluation based on ISO-10993 and compliance of milk-contacting components with 21 CFR 177.1520, leveraging information from the predicate device.
    • Bench Performance Testing: Confirming minimum/maximum vacuum levels and cycle rates, and demonstrating sustained specifications over its use life.

    These tests are standard for a breast pump and focus on physical and electrical safety and performance parameters, not on the diagnostic accuracy or classification capabilities that would typically require the kind of "acceptance criteria" table and study details (sample size, ground truth, expert consensus, MRMC studies) you've requested.

    Intended Use

    MIM software is used by trained medical professionals as a tool to aid in evaluation and information management of digital medical images. The medical image modalities include, but are not limited to, CT. MRI. CR. DX. MG. US. SPECT. PET and XA as supported by ACRNEMA DICOM 3.0. MIM assists in the following indications:

    • · Receive, transmit, store, retrieve, display, print, and process medical images and DICOM objects.
    • · Create, display and print reports from medical images.
    • · Registration, fusion display, and review of medical images for diagnosis, treatment planning,
      · Evaluation of cardiac left ventricular function, including left ventricular end-diastolic volume, end-systolic volume, and ejection fraction.
      · Localization and definition of objects such as tumors and normal tissues in medical images.
      · Creation, transformation, and modification of contours for applications including, but not limited to, quantitative analysis, aiding adaptive therapy, transfering contours to radiation therapy treatment planning systems, and archiving contours for patient follow-up and management.
      · Quantitative and statistical analysis of PET/SPECT brain scans by comparing to other registered PET/SPECT brain scans.
      · Planning and evaluation of permanent implant brachytherapy procedures (not including radioactive microspheres).
    • · Post-treatment dose calculation of permanent Yttrium-90 (Y90) microsphere implants.
      Lossy compressed mammographic images and digitized film screen images must not be reviewed for primary image interpretations. Images that are printed to film must be printed using a FDA-approved printer for the diagnosis of digital mammography images. Mammographic images must be viewed on a display system that has been cleared by the FDA for the diagnosis of digital mammography images.

    The software is not to be used for mammography CAD.

    Device Description

    MIM - SPECTRA Quant is a feature of MIM. It is designed for use in medical imaging and operates on both Windows and Mac computer systems. MIM - SPECTRA Quant extends the functionality MIM - Y90 Dosimetry (K172218) software. The following functions have been added to allow quantitative reconstructions of Single Photon Emission Computed Tomography (SPECT) scans:

    • Allows for decay correction of activity back to time of injection ●
    • Allows for correction of photon attenuation ●
    • . Allows for correction of photon scatter
    • Allows for correction of collimator detector resolution effects ●
    • Allows for camera sensitivity calibration providing output in Becquerels per ml (Bq/ml) .
